Disney POP TOWN Mod is a match-3 puzzle game built around Disney and Pixar characters. The core gameplay involves swapping adjacent tiles to create rows or columns of three or more identical character icons. Completing levels earns stars and resources used to rebuild and decorate a central town hub with themed buildings. The game is primarily targeted at a casual audience familiar with the match-3 genre and Disney franchises.
